On This Day In 1977 Concorde Made Its First Visit to New York’s
JFK Airport. It was no-passenger proving flight from Toulouse
to JFK.
The supersonic jet was initially barred from the Big Apple due
to noise concerns. The ban came to an end on 17 October.
The Concorde was operated by a crew of three: two pilots
and a flight engineer.

The Dow Jones industrial average dropped 508 points on this day in 1987. It was called Black Monday, the worst one-day percentage
decline, 22.6%, in history.
